Protein NameSerine/threonine-protein kinase SRK2D
Protein Synonyms/Alias OST1-kinase-like 3; Protein ATHPROKIN A; SNF1-related kinase 2.2; SnRK2.2;
Gene NameSRK2D
Gene Synonyms/Alias SRK2D; OSKL3, SNRK2.2, SPK2; At3g50500; T20E23.100;
Ensembl Information
Ensembl Gene IDEnsembl Protein IDEnsembl Transcript ID
AT3G50500AT3G50500.2AT3G50500.2
AT3G50500AT3G50500.1AT3G50500.1
OrganismArabidopsis thaliana
Functional DescriptionTogether with SRK2I, key component and activator of theabscisic acid (ABA) signaling pathway that regulates numerous ABA responses, such as seed germination, Pro accumulation, root growth inhibition, dormancy and seedling growth, and, to a lesser extent, stomatal closure.
